For the former case, always return 1. For the latter case, return 1 iff the kernel was built for BE (implying that the BE MMIO accessors do not perform a swap). Otherwise return 0, assuming LE registers. LE registers are assumed by default because most existing drivers (libahci, serial8250, usb) always use readl/writel in the absence of instructions to the contrary, so that will be our fallback.
